Sea Of Stars Launches On Mobile Devices Today

Sea of Stars was one of our favorite games of 2023, and you can now bring the acclaimed RPG everywhere you go with its arrival to iOS and Android today.

Inspired by classic JRPGs like Chrono Trigger and Final Fantasy VI, Sea of Stars comes from Sabotage Studios, developer of The Messenger. In fact, Sea of Stars is a distant prequel to The Messenger and stars two warriors, Valere and Zale, who wield the power of the Moon and Sun, respectively. The pair teams up with their childhood friend and battle chef, Garl, to take on an evil alchemist known as The Fleshmancer. 

You can purchase the game for $9.99 on iOS and Android, though a special launch sale temporarily knocks this price down by 10 percent ($8.99) until April 14. Check out the mobile trailer below. 

 

The mobile version of Sea of Stars does not appear to include its free post-game story DLC, Throes of the Watchmaker, so players will have to wait and see if that also makes the jump. 

Editor Kyle Hilliard scored Sea of Stars a 9 out of 10 in his review, writing, “Sea of Stars is a stellar throwback that appeals to fans like me who love 16-bit RPGs, but it also functions as an excellent entry point. Annoyances that hindered early games that inspired Sea of Stars are nowhere to be seen. Simple actions like moving around the world feel great, the story picks up quickly, and farming experience is effectively unnecessary. It all leads to a smooth, consistently thrilling adventure with fun combat, all in a gorgeous and inviting world.”

Sea of Stars is also available on PlayStation and Xbox platforms, Switch, and PC. If you’re jumping into the game for the first time via this mobile port, be sure to read our list of tips for starting the adventure.
